Why this grade

Sony is the documentation leader here: it officially publishes Right-to-Repair service manuals and a self-repair parts program through Encompass/SonyParts, so schematics and OEM parts are obtainable through legitimate channels. The notable downside is firmware pairing - Sony main boards must be firmware-matched to the panel/T-CON, so a board swap requires a firmware update to fully sync (extra friction vs. other brands, hence a lower software-lock score). OEM parts via Encompass tend to be pricier, and panel replacement remains uneconomical, holding the overall grade to D despite best-in-class manuals.
